Holmen AB (publ) (STO:HOLM.B)
Sweden flag Sweden · Delayed Price · Currency is SEK
378.20
-1.00 (-0.26%)
Aug 12, 2025, 5:29 PM CET

Holmen AB Income Statement

Millions SEK.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Operating Revenue
22,69122,75922,79523,95219,47916,296
Upgrade
Other Revenue
950950783849584411
Upgrade
Revenue
23,64123,70923,57824,80120,06316,707
Upgrade
Revenue Growth (YoY)
1.84%0.56%-4.93%23.62%20.09%-3.60%
Upgrade
Cost of Revenue
12,58012,51911,24110,71410,1098,838
Upgrade
Gross Profit
11,06111,19012,33714,0879,9547,869
Upgrade
Selling, General & Admin
3,4023,3893,3122,9562,7202,411
Upgrade
Other Operating Expenses
3,7383,6303,5003,2143,0282,441
Upgrade
Operating Expenses
8,5668,4078,1727,5157,0096,024
Upgrade
Operating Income
2,4952,7834,1656,5722,9451,845
Upgrade
Interest Expense
-116-101-100-70-46-52
Upgrade
Interest & Investment Income
20354911811
Upgrade
Earnings From Equity Investments
67610--6
Upgrade
Currency Exchange Gain (Loss)
44----
Upgrade
Other Non Operating Income (Expenses)
54--161-5
Upgrade
EBT Excluding Unusual Items
2,4142,7324,1206,5072,9081,793
Upgrade
Gain (Loss) on Sale of Investments
-4-41-12-6
Upgrade
Gain (Loss) on Sale of Assets
2121153532059
Upgrade
Asset Writedown
1,063907562422464579
Upgrade
Pretax Income
3,4973,6594,7057,4413,6922,437
Upgrade
Income Tax Expense
7697981,0081,567688458
Upgrade
Net Income
2,7282,8613,6975,8743,0041,979
Upgrade
Net Income to Common
2,7282,8613,6975,8743,0041,979
Upgrade
Net Income Growth
-6.67%-22.61%-37.06%95.54%51.79%-77.33%
Upgrade
Shares Outstanding (Basic)
158159160162162162
Upgrade
Shares Outstanding (Diluted)
158159160162162162
Upgrade
Shares Change (YoY)
-1.32%-1.06%-0.93%0.03%--2.51%
Upgrade
EPS (Basic)
17.3218.0223.0436.2618.5512.22
Upgrade
EPS (Diluted)
17.3018.0023.0036.2618.5012.20
Upgrade
EPS Growth
-5.32%-21.74%-36.58%96.03%51.64%-76.79%
Upgrade
Free Cash Flow
1,3501,2034,1464,0991,5291,297
Upgrade
Free Cash Flow Per Share
8.577.5825.8425.319.448.01
Upgrade
Dividend Per Share
9.0009.0008.5008.0007.5007.250
Upgrade
Dividend Growth
5.88%5.88%6.25%6.67%3.45%107.14%
Upgrade
Gross Margin
46.79%47.20%52.32%56.80%49.61%47.10%
Upgrade
Operating Margin
10.55%11.74%17.66%26.50%14.68%11.04%
Upgrade
Profit Margin
11.54%12.07%15.68%23.69%14.97%11.85%
Upgrade
Free Cash Flow Margin
5.71%5.07%17.58%16.53%7.62%7.76%
Upgrade
EBITDA
3,7934,0435,4107,8264,0952,921
Upgrade
EBITDA Margin
16.04%17.05%22.95%31.55%20.41%17.48%
Upgrade
D&A For EBITDA
1,2981,2601,2451,2541,1501,076
Upgrade
EBIT
2,4952,7834,1656,5722,9451,845
Upgrade
EBIT Margin
10.55%11.74%17.66%26.50%14.68%11.04%
Upgrade
Effective Tax Rate
21.99%21.81%21.42%21.06%18.63%18.79%
Upgrade
Updated Mar 7,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.